1987 BMW 7 Series 735IL review from Iceland
"This car has chanced my live for the better"
What things have gone wrong with the car?
The Self-leveling suspension leaked when I got it fixed it my self.
Driving light's didn't work (previous owner had the wiring done by a amature)
and the sub-frame bussings wore out at about 300.k
the driver's seat is twisted and the leather is torn
the head gasket blew at 315.000km.
General comments?
Well I have had my ups and downs with this car, but mostly because of my own mistakes. this is the most comfortable car I have owned, and because it's an IL it has plenty of space in the back (IL stands for an extra 15cm leg room in the back)
The performance is good and it is surprisingly nimble for a car it's size, never a problem to park at the local super-market even though it has small parking spaces...
